Should I consider solar shingles when I replace my roof, or stick with traditional ones?
The decision balances energy generation with upfront cost. Traditional architectural shingles are a proven, lower-cost barrier. Integrated solar shingles offer a streamlined look and qualify for the 30% federal Investment Tax Credit, but lack a mandatory utility buy-back program in Shady Shores. In 2026, the math depends on your energy consumption, long-term home ownership plans, and whether you prioritize pure weather protection or integrated energy production.

Could my attic ventilation be causing problems with my roof?
Improper ventilation on a 4/12 pitch roof leads to attic heat buildup in summer and moisture accumulation in winter, which can bake or warp shingles from below and promote decking mold. The 2021 IRC, as amended locally, specifies a balanced system of soffit intake and ridge exhaust. Correcting this protects the roof structure and improves overall home energy efficiency, directly extending the shingle service life.
What makes a roof 'storm-proof' for our area's severe weather?
Storm resilience in Shady Shores requires addressing both high wind and hail. The 115 mph Ultimate Wind Speed Zone demands enhanced decking attachment and high-wind rated shingles. For the High hail risk, Class 4 impact-resistant shingles are a financial necessity; they resist damage from 1.75-inch+ hail common in our spring supercell season, reducing claim frequency and protecting your deductible. This dual-focus approach is built for our specific peak seasons.
My homeowner's insurance premium keeps going up. Can my roof help lower it?
The 28% premium trend in Texas is directly tied to storm loss. Installing a roof certified to the IBHS FORTIFIED Home standard can qualify you for significant credits through the Texas FORTIFIED Home Program. Insurers view these roofs as high-resilience assets, reducing their risk and your cost. This investment often pays for itself through premium savings long before the roof's warranty expires.
What are the current code requirements for a roof replacement in Shady Shores?
All work must be permitted through the Town of Shady Shores Building Department and performed by a contractor licensed by the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ation. The 2021 IRC with NCTCOG amendments now mandates specific ice and water shield application in eaves and valleys, along with upgraded flashing details. These code-minimums are designed for our climate and are legally required for insurance and future home sale compliance.
